Mary Alexander studied the effects of radiation on mutation rates in he sperm of Drosophila melanogaster. She exposed Drosophila larvae to either 3000 roentgens (r) or 3975 r of radiation, collected the adult males that developed from irradiated larvae, and mated them with nonirradiated females that were homozygous for recessive alleles at eight loci. She then counted the number of F, flies that carried a new mutation at each locus. All mutant flies that appeared were used in subsequent crosses to determine if their mutant phenotypes were heritable. For the roughoid locus, she obtained the following results (M. L. Alexander. 1954. Genetics 39:409-428): Number of Offspring with a mutation at offspring Group the roughoid locus Control (0 r) Irradiated 45,504 49,512 (3000 r) Irradiated 50,159 16 (3975 r)
